    ok i wanna build a 3in exaust from the downpipe back....i'm planning on ditching the cats but does it need the resonator? how should i go about doing it? i was thinking a y pipe off of the downpipe and having dual exhaust all the way back instead of just before the gas tank...good idea or bad? any suggestions, pointers etc...lemme know

    There is really no room for true duals under the car, and its gonna sound crappy anyway.

    You do want a resonator, as it elminates ALOT of rasp in the exhuast, the bigger, the better.

    When you get back to the bends, get some 3" mandrel bent pipes for them.

    After its all said and done, you don't need 3" exhuast on a gp unless your pushing past 400whp. 2.5" will do just fine.

    get headers, make the downpipe the same size as the header collector, and at some point make the step down to 2.5" and run whatever else you want behind it (resonator, mufflers, glasspacks, etc).

    there is NO reason to run 3" unless you have a turbo car. it will just be loud and youll gain no power. true dual is...well it's stupid. it is nearly impossible to run the piping and youll also gain no sound or performance from doing it. keep the exhaust similar to how it is now.
